    Choosing the Right Partner When selecting a welding electrodes supplier, consider those who invest in building relationships beyond mere transactions. The ideal supplier will function as a strategic partner, advising on cost-effective solutions, and offering training sessions for proper product usage. They should also have a robust understanding of regulatory requirements, ensuring your operations remain compliant.

    One significant factor that indicates a reliable supplier is their extensive experience in the industry. Experienced suppliers have weathered various market changes and technological advancements, allowing them to offer insights and solutions that newer entities may not provide. They understand the nuances of different electrode types, such as SMAW (Shielded Metal Arc Welding), GTAW (Gas Tungsten Arc Welding), and GMAW (Gas Metal Arc Welding), and can recommend the best options for specific projects.
